Output 86093398ac5db1c12fa5deb450c9a3e49ac29b7858103244ad7a3ba9b9ad5304:0

value
185000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dca891cfc44725cf43cb47eb6622813209758ee9 OP_EQUAL
address
3MokXAaXVijxn7q9hDYmYua97HLdXaHwWT
transaction
86093398ac5db1c12fa5deb450c9a3e49ac29b7858103244ad7a3ba9b9ad5304
confirmations
273314
spent
true